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 07/02/2012, à 14:25

neeteex

[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Bonjour,

Sur mon Lubuntu 11.10 KMyMoney installé avec apt-get marchait assez bien, mais de nombreuses corrections apportées dans la dernière version m'intéressent, et les dépôts ne sont pas à jour.

Je cherche donc à installer la dernière version de KMyMoney, dispo ici : 4.6.2 for KDE Platform 4 (stable)

Une doc explique à peu près comment faire ici : Compiler KMyMoney depuis les sources

Le soucis c'est que j'ai beau installer de plus en plus de paquets nécessaires, il en manque toujours !

Démo en image :

raphaelle@raphaelle:~$ cd Bureau/kmymoney-4.6.2/
raphaelle@raphaelle:~/Bureau/kmymoney-4.6.2$ mkdir build
raphaelle@raphaelle:~/Bureau/kmymoney-4.6.2$ cd build
raphaelle@raphaelle:~/Bureau/kmymoney-4.6.2/build$ cmake .. -DCMAKE_INSTALL_PREFIX=/usr/
-- The C compiler identification is GNU
-- The CXX compiler identification is GNU
-- Check for working C compiler: /usr/bin/gcc
-- Check for working C compiler: /usr/bin/gcc -- works
-- Detecting C compiler ABI info
-- Detecting C compiler ABI info - done
-- Check for working CXX compiler: /usr/bin/c++
-- Check for working CXX compiler: /usr/bin/c++ -- works
-- Detecting CXX compiler ABI info
-- Detecting CXX compiler ABI info - done
-- Looking for Q_WS_X11
-- Looking for Q_WS_X11 - found
-- Looking for Q_WS_WIN
-- Looking for Q_WS_WIN - not found.
-- Looking for Q_WS_QWS
-- Looking for Q_WS_QWS - not found.
-- Looking for Q_WS_MAC
-- Looking for Q_WS_MAC - not found.
-- Found Qt-Version 4.7.4 (using /usr/bin/qmake)
-- Looking for XOpenDisplay in /usr/lib/i386-linux-gnu/libX11.so;/usr/lib/i386-linux-gnu/libXext.so;/usr/lib/i386-linux-gnu/libXau.so;/usr/lib/i386-linux-gnu/libXdmcp.so
-- Looking for XOpenDisplay in /usr/lib/i386-linux-gnu/libX11.so;/usr/lib/i386-linux-gnu/libXext.so;/usr/lib/i386-linux-gnu/libXau.so;/usr/lib/i386-linux-gnu/libXdmcp.so - found
-- Looking for gethostbyname
-- Looking for gethostbyname - found
-- Looking for connect
-- Looking for connect - found
-- Looking for remove
-- Looking for remove - found
-- Looking for shmat
-- Looking for shmat - found
-- Found X11: /usr/lib/i386-linux-gnu/libX11.so
-- Looking for include files CMAKE_HAVE_PTHREAD_H
-- Looking for include files CMAKE_HAVE_PTHREAD_H - found
-- Looking for pthread_create in pthreads
-- Looking for pthread_create in pthreads - not found
-- Looking for pthread_create in pthread
-- Looking for pthread_create in pthread - found
-- Found Threads: TRUE 
-- Looking for _POSIX_TIMERS
-- Looking for _POSIX_TIMERS - found
-- Found Automoc4: /usr/bin/automoc4 
-- Found Perl: /usr/bin/perl 
-- Found Phonon: /usr/include 
-- Performing Test _OFFT_IS_64BIT
-- Performing Test _OFFT_IS_64BIT - Failed
-- Performing Test HAVE_FPIE_SUPPORT
-- Performing Test HAVE_FPIE_SUPPORT - Success
-- Performing Test __KDE_HAVE_W_OVERLOADED_VIRTUAL
-- Performing Test __KDE_HAVE_W_OVERLOADED_VIRTUAL - Success
-- Performing Test __KDE_HAVE_GCC_VISIBILITY
-- Performing Test __KDE_HAVE_GCC_VISIBILITY - Success
-- Found KDE 4.7 include dir: /usr/include
-- Found KDE 4.7 library dir: /usr/lib
-- Found the KDE4 kconfig_compiler preprocessor: /usr/bin/kconfig_compiler
-- Found automoc4: /usr/bin/automoc4
-- Boost version: 1.46.1
-- Found the following Boost libraries:
--   graph
-- Found gpgme-config at /usr/bin/gpgme-config
-- Found gpgme v1.2.0, checking for flavours...
--  Found flavour 'vanilla', checking whether it's usable...yes
--  Found flavour 'pthread', checking whether it's usable...yes
--  Found flavour 'pth', checking whether it's usable...yes
-- Usable gpgme flavours found:  vanilla pthread pth
-- Found QGpgme: /usr/lib/libqgpgme.so 
-- Found KdepimLibs: /usr/lib/cmake/KdepimLibs/KdepimLibsConfig.cmake 
-- Found SharedMimeInfo: /usr/bin/update-mime-database  (found version "0.90", required is "0.18")
-- Could NOT find Doxygen (missing:  DOXYGEN_EXECUTABLE) 
CMake Error at /usr/share/kde4/apps/cmake/modules/FindPackageHandleStandardArgs.cmake:198 (MESSAGE):
  Could NOT find GMP (missing: GMP_INCLUDE_DIR GMP_LIBRARIES)
Call Stack (most recent call first):
  /usr/share/kde4/apps/cmake/modules/FindGMP.cmake:21 (FIND_PACKAGE_HANDLE_STANDARD_ARGS)
  CMakeLists.txt:94 (FIND_PACKAGE)


-- Configuring incomplete, errors occurred!
raphaelle@raphaelle:~/Bureau/kmymoney-4.6.2/build$ make
make: *** Pas de cibles spécifiées et aucun makefile n'a été trouvé. Arrêt.

Faut-il que j'installe tout KDE, ou seulement une partie ? Comment m'en sortir ?

Merci smile

Dernière modification par neeteex (Le 08/02/2012, à 03:42)

Hors ligne

#2 Le 08/02/2012, à 03:41

neeteex

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Bon c'est résolu car j'ai eu de l'aide sur irc, je dois dire que seul c'est bien compliqué de trouver toutes les bibliothèques qui vont bien.

Hors ligne

#3 Le 12/02/2012, à 09:23

penbeuz

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Comment as tu fait, j'ai le même problème.


Quand on a dépassé les bornes, y'a plus de limites

Hors ligne

#4 Le 12/02/2012, à 11:40

neeteex

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

penbeuz a écrit :

Comment as tu fait, j'ai le même problème.

J'ai analysé ET fait analyser par des internautes plus habitués les retour console des commandes réalisées. A chaque fois, on pouvait voir des manques, comme sur le log ci-dessus :


-- Could NOT find Doxygen (missing:  DOXYGEN_EXECUTABLE) 
CMake Error at /usr/share/kde4/apps/cmake/modules/FindPackageHandleStandardArgs.cmake:198 (MESSAGE):
  Could NOT find GMP (missing: GMP_INCLUDE_DIR GMP_LIBRARIES)

De là, le jeu est de trouver où et comment installer ce qu'il manque, et là vaut mieux avoir de l'aide de qqun, sur IRC #ubuntu par exemple, car sur un forum ça peut prendre longtemps.

Note : le développeur m'a demandé la liste des librairies manquantes, je me souviens de Libalkimia (qu'il m'a fallu compiler) et de Doxygen (demandé ci-dessus), mais si tu peux garder la liste de tout ce que tu dois installer ce serait sympa de la publier ici.

Hors ligne

#5 Le 12/02/2012, à 23:20

penbeuz

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

je progresse, mais avant de rédiger la solution il faut que ça compile et là je bloque avec Libalkimia, comment as tu fait?


Quand on a dépassé les bornes, y'a plus de limites

Hors ligne

#6 Le 12/02/2012, à 23:26

neeteex

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Pas d'autre solution que de télécharger la source sur le site officiel, de la compiler ET de l'installer. ATTENTION, contrairement à ce que propose la doc de kmymoney (make) qui se contente de compiler (rendre exécutable) il faut impérativement INSTALLER libalkimia avec  la commande "sudo make install". Même chose pour kmymoney si tu veux pouvoir l'utiliser depuis les menus du gestionnaire de bureau, d'ailleurs.

Bonne continuation, et n'hésite pas à demander de l'aide sur #ubuntu, car retrouver le paquet correspondant à la bibliothèque est parfois trapu...

Hors ligne

#7 Le 16/02/2012, à 00:03

penbeuz

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Déjà un gros progrès, une bonne âme a fait un package pour la version 4.6.1 smile

sudo add-apt-repository ppa:claydoh/kmymoney2-kde4
sudo apt-get install kmymoney

La version 4.6.1 fonctionne
La librairie Libalkimia est inclue mais il me manque encore quelques lib pour que 4.6.2 compile


Quand on a dépassé les bornes, y'a plus de limites

Hors ligne

#8 Le 16/02/2012, à 06:03

neeteex

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

Effectivement c'est un mieux indiscutable. Comme quoi rien ne sert de courir !

Par contre je ne comprends pas pourquoi cette bonne âme a choisi d'ajouter le 4.6.1 alors que le 4.6.2 est disponible... Peut-être pour des raisons de dépendances et de librairies, justement ? A moins que cet ajout ne soit antérieur à la 4.6.2, auquel cas j'avais insuffisamment cherché !

Hors ligne

#9 Le 26/03/2012, à 21:02

SylvaiNN

Re : [Résolu] Quels paquets pour KMyMoney à jour sous lubuntu 11.10

penbeuz a écrit :

Déjà un gros progrès, une bonne âme a fait un package pour la version 4.6.1 smile

sudo add-apt-repository ppa:claydoh/kmymoney2-kde4
sudo apt-get install kmymoney

La version 4.6.1 fonctionne
La librairie Libalkimia est inclue mais il me manque encore quelques lib pour que 4.6.2 compile

Merci pour cette astuce !
J'ai pu facilement installer la 4.6.1 ainsi mais toujours pas de 4.6.2 sad
Si quelqu'un a une astuce qu'il n'hésite pas big_smile


Kubuntu 16.04 64bits
INTEL NUC D34010WYKH2 (i3 4010U) | 2x4Go PC12800 | SSD CRUCIAL M500 120 Go msata | Disque dur HITACHI Travelstar 7K1000 - 1 To | Carte Wifi Intel 6235AN.HMWWB

Hors ligne